Making the inactive accounts active again in QuickBooks Desktop is pretty easy. If the option to Make Account Active is grayed out, you can follow the steps below to activate them again.

 

  1. Click Lists at the top menu bar and choose Chart of Accounts.
  2. At the bottom, click the drop-down arrow and select Show Inactive Accounts.
  3. Click the X mark beside the inactive accounts. This will make the account active again.
